What is an Echeck?
An echeck is an electronic version of a physical check, allowing funds to be transferred directly from one bank account to another without the use of paper. This system leverages the Automated Clearing House (ACH) network, which is a secure electronic payment system that banks use to process a variety of transactions, including payroll and payments. With echeck processing, online casinos facilitate faster, more secure deposits compared to traditional methods. Here are several key features of echecks:
- Speed: Echecks can be processed in a matter of days, rather than the weeks it can take for a physical check to clear.
- Security: As an electronic transaction, echecks reduce the risk of check fraud and loss.
- Convenience: Players can fund their casino accounts directly from their bank accounts without needing to withdraw cash or obtain a paper check.
- Cost-effective: Echecks often have lower fees compared to credit card transactions or other payment methods.
How Echeck Deposit Processing Works
The echeck deposit process in online casinos typically involves the following steps:
- Select Echeck as Your Payment Method: When you’re ready to make a deposit, choose echeck from the list of available payment options.
- Enter Your Bank Information: Fill in the required information, including your bank account number and routing number.
- Specify the Deposit Amount: Indicate how much you want to deposit into your online casino account.
- Confirm the Transaction: Review all details and confirm the transaction. The casino will process your echeck and funds will be deducted from your bank account.
- Wait for Processing: The echeck will be submitted through the ACH network for verification and processing, which usually takes 3-5 business days.
Advantages and Disadvantages of Using Echeck in Online Casinos
While echeck deposits provide a number of benefits for online casino players, there are also some disadvantages worth considering. Understanding both aspects can help users make an informed choice when selecting their preferred payment method.
Advantages:
- Ease of Use: Echecks are straightforward to use and can be initiated quickly from your bank account.
- Higher Limits: Many online casinos impose higher deposit limits for echeck payments compared to other methods.
- Less Fraud: The electronic nature of echecks makes them less vulnerable to theft and fraud than paper checks.
Disadvantages:
- Processing Time: While faster than paper checks, echecks still take time to clear compared to instant methods like credit cards or e-wallets.
- Bank Restrictions: Some banks may not allow echeck transactions, or might flag them as unusual behavior.
- Account Verification Requirements: Players may need to verify their bank account details, which can delay the deposit process.

FAQs
1. Are echeck deposits safe for online casino gaming?
Yes, echeck deposits are generally safe due to the secure processing through banks and the ACH network, minimizing the risk of fraud and theft.
2. How long does it take for an echeck to process?
Echeck transactions typically take 3-5 business days to process and clear, depending on the casino and the bank involved.
3. Can I withdraw my winnings using an echeck?
Many online casinos allow withdrawals via echeck, but you should always check the specific withdrawal methods available at your chosen casino.
4. What happens if my echeck transaction is rejected?
If your echeck transaction is rejected, the funds will not be deducted from your bank account, and you’ll usually receive a notification regarding the issue.
5. Are there fees associated with echeck deposits?
While many online casinos do not charge fees for echeck deposits, your bank might impose fees, so it’s advisable to verify with your financial institution.
